Bizibody at the ADR Conference 2025

Last week on 22 and 23 May, our team at Bizibody Technology had a great time at the Alternative Dispute Resolution Conference 2025, held at Pan Pacific. Jointly organised by LAWASIA and the Law Society of Singapore, the two-day conference saw over 200 passionate legal minds from across Asia, all buzzing with ideas about the future of mediation and arbitration.
